Output f580e3c232448386a86b4c066802363859a442d5bd2a15cfd0f09d9c8cb35526:19

value
130684696
script pubkey
OP_0 OP_PUSHBYTES_32 5654f19bfaa38e597c34ddf18b9e870f1c05bace8c497e92004d22eb0bd9c929
address
bc1q2e20rxl65w89jlp5mhcch858puwqtwkw33yhaysqf53wkz7eey5s09qmxu
transaction
f580e3c232448386a86b4c066802363859a442d5bd2a15cfd0f09d9c8cb35526
spent
true